What the fine print actually says

  • Maximum win capped at £5 – you’ll thank the casino when you finally hit it.
  • Wagering requirement of 40x – because the house loves arithmetic.
  • 30‑day expiry – the same speed as a slow‑drip coffee that turns cold.

Because nothing says “we care” like a deadline that forces you to gamble under pressure. The whole package is a textbook case of a “VIP” experience that feels more like a cheap motel with fresh paint – you’re welcomed, but the curtains are thin and the plumbing leaks.

Real‑world example: The spin that wasn’t

Imagine you sign up on a site that advertises bcgame casino free spins no deposit 2026. You receive two spins on an entry‑level slot. First spin lands a small win – £0.20. You’re thrilled, but the second spin is a loss, and you’re reminded of the 40x wagering on that £0.20. In a week you’ve churned through three promotions, each time the “free” spin leaves you with a fraction of a pound and a mountain of required play.
